Safety and Efficacy Study of the NG Shield, a Device Intended to Reduce Pain and Discomfort Level Related to Nasogasstric Tube Usage
Evaluation of Safety and Efficacy of the NasoGastric Shield (NG Shield) in Healthy Subjects With Indwelling Nasogastric Tube

Summary
The purpose of the study i to demonstrate the safety and efficacy of a device that intends to reduce pain/discomfort related to nasogfastric tube usage by reducing the friction between the tube and internal orifice (nose and pharynx)using micro vibrations
